With yesterday’s long awaited time trial done, the GC had a settled look last night. True, none of the contenders had actually attacked, apart from Bilbao, on a descent on the road to Tortoreto. Yet, with young guns Almeida and McNulty first and fourth, proven talents Kelderman and Bilbao second and third, and those wily old campaigners Nibali, Majka and Pozzovivo ready to pounce in the final week, and a final climb today that, in Wilco Kelderman’s words this morning, didn’t look long enough to open big gaps, Stage 15 looked like one for the breakaway.
